Molecular genetic analysis and clinical characterization of Rickettsia species isolated from the Republic of Korea in 2017.

Rickettsia sp. CNH17‐7 was isolated from patients' blood and identified by gene analysis as a species distinct from Rickettsia japonica . In addition, similar rickettsial infection was confirmed in two species (Haemaphysalis longicornis and Ixodes nipponensis ) of ticks and rodents in northeastern and southwestern provinces, Republic of Korea. Subsequently, the analysis of 16S rRNA, ompA , ompB and sca4 genes of isolate CNH17‐7 revealed 100%, 99.68%, 99.57% and 99.44% sequence similarity with Rickettsia sp. HlR/D91 and Candidatus R. longicornii ROK‐HL727. In this study, we report the isolation of a new Rickettsia sp. CNH17‐7 and infection of different types of ticks with the same rickettsial agents.
